Object of the Fortnight #3 – Baseball (ball)  ⚾️

This object was chosen by the last winner: Woodsy.  Your baseball must not have any labels on it.

 

The deadline for entries is 0100 UTC (1:00 AM UK Time) on Saturday, February 25.
To see how that equates to other countries, see the World Time clock or the UTC Time Zone map.

 

 

Competition Rules:

0. Your baseball must not have any labels on it.

1. Your entry must not have a background/backdrop/scene; just the object.* Shadows are fine.

2. Your entry must be 100% made using Paint.net. Don't use another image editor. Don't use stock images/photos (in full or parts thereof).

3. Max dimensions are 800x800.*

4. You may modify or replace your image until the deadline.

5. Multiple entries per entrant are allowed. Make a separate post for each one.

 

*You may link to alternative versions, but they will not be part of your entry.
